What is the size of stack space available for a compiled and uncompiled Quick Script?
In VA One 2010 the stack size for uncompiled is 8192 bytes, for compiled is 2048 bytes. In VA One 2010.5 the stack size will be 8192 bytes for both compiled and uncompiled scripts.

How do I apply a discrete velocity/acceleration constraint to an FE subsystem?
An acceleration or velocity constraint can be applied to the node of an FE subsystem using the "large mass method".

How can I get an accurate Radiation Loss Factor to use in my SEA model?
One can use a hybrid model with an FE subsystem with an FE face connected to a SIF, and calculate the radiation efficiency. From this the radiation loss factor can be calculate

Does VA One SEA use cached data when solving in batch mode?
Yes. With a .va1 as input to the batch solve, VA One SEA will use the CLF's cached in that .va1 if they exist. However, when passed a .ntf or .xml file VA One SEA solves from scratch each time.

How can I reduce the size of the modal data imported in a hybrid model?
The model will always contain enough data to solve, and give basic results. For models with hybrid area junctions, nodal data for all wetted faces will be generated/recovered which results in much data.
